Watch: Kim Kardashian Plays Power Lawyer in Teaser for ‘All’s Fair’

This fall, Hulu sets the stage for courtroom drama with a fierce twist in Ryan Murphy’s upcoming legal series, All’s Fair. In a first-look teaser that has already generated buzz, Kim Kardashian steps confidently into the role of Allura Grant—a formidable divorce attorney who leads a top-tier, all-female law firm.

Known for her ventures into fashion and beauty, Kardashian now commands the screen with poised authority in her latest acting turn.

The teaser opens with a calm yet powerful line: “Deep breath. Tell us your story.” It’s a subtle but firm introduction to Kardashian’s character, establishing the no-nonsense tone of the show. Set in the high-stakes world of elite family law, All’s Fair follows a group of lawyers who break away from a male-dominated firm to launch their own powerhouse practice. Their mission: to take control of their careers, and deliver results with precision and flair.

From the dramatic lighting to the sleek office interiors, the visual palette of the teaser is sharply modern—underscoring the series’ stylish appeal. The cast is equally impressive. Joining Kardashian are veteran actors Glenn Close, Sarah Paulson, and Naomi Watts, along with Niecy Nash-Betts and Teyana Taylor. Each plays a key member of the legal dream team, navigating courtroom battles and complex client relationships with equal parts strategy and steel.

As the trailer unfolds, viewers catch glimpses of courtroom confrontations, client scandals, and private conflicts behind closed doors. Judith Light delivers a standout moment with a quip that sets the tone: “You know what a girl’s best friend is? Not diamonds. Her lawyers.” It’s clear that in this world, legal expertise is the most powerful asset.

The series is more than just legal battles—it’s a character-driven drama that delves into ambition, loyalty, and personal transformation. According to the official synopsis, the attorneys are “fierce, brilliant, and emotionally complicated,” working in a world where “money talks and love is a battleground.” These women aren’t just navigating the legal system—they’re rewriting its rules.

While this is Kardashian’s second collaboration with Murphy (following American Horror Story: Delicate), All’s Fair marks a new level of visibility for her acting career. In real life, Kardashian has been pursuing law herself, having passed California’s baby bar exam and advocated for justice reform. That real-world experience lends added weight to her portrayal of Allura Grant.

Behind the scenes, All’s Fair is powered by a strong creative team. Ryan Murphy serves as creator, writer, and director, with Kardashian, Close, Paulson, Watts, Nash-Betts, and even Kris Jenner listed as executive producers. With such a lineup, the series is poised to make a statement.

Sleek, sharp, and full of courtroom intrigue, All’s Fair is scheduled to premiere on Hulu this fall—promising high drama and high style in equal measure.
